RON is just an abbreviation of Research Octane Number (RON) which signifies the branches of the hydrocarbons. There are three kinds of RON gasoline in Malaysia: RON95, RON97, and RON100. People usually think RON has something to do with the quality of petrol which translates into the different prices between them both. The higher the RON number, the higher the quality and the more expensive the price.
The numbers such as RON95 or RON97 signify the number of hydrocarbon branches. The higher numbers indicate its higher level of compression required to detonate the fuel. Higher compression levels may mean more power output, depending on the type of vehicle specifications. If your vehicle’s recommended fuel requirement is RON95. For details, you can check the car manual, which one RON is recommended.
The main advantages of a diesel engine compared with a gasoline one come in terms of fuel efficiency, engine reliability, and power. Because diesel engines are built to withstand higher compression, they tend to be more reliable and last longer than gasoline engines. Another reason diesel engines last longer than gas engines is due to the fuel that they burn. Diesel fuel is a type of distillate fuel that is essentially produced from crude oil, which gives diesel engines slower cylinder wear than gasoline engines.
